Professional statement
Professor Richard E. Field is a world-renowned hip and knee surgeon with practices in both the NHS and Private sectors. He is the Professor of Orthopaedic Surgery at St George’s University of London. He was appointed on the staff of St Helier Hospital, Surrey in 1994 where his NHS practice was based until the South West London Elective Orthopaedic Centre (SWLEOC) opened in 2004. He has been SWLEOC's Director of Research since the centre opened and leads the centre's academic surgical team. His private practices are based at the Lister Hospital in Chelsea and St Anthony’s Hospital in Cheam.
Professor Richard Field qualified from the Westminster Hospital in 1980. His PhD was undertaken at Cambridge University, on the design of a hip resurfacing implant. He has been actively involved in the design and evaluation of new hip and knee designs throughout his career. Professor Field has undertaken many world-first operations. His pioneering work in arthroscopic hip surgery was recognised by his Presidency of ISHA, the International Society for Hip Preservation Surgery in 2016-17.
Professor Field has been undertaking hip resurfacing since 1995 and adopted the muscle sparing, Direct Anterior Approach (DAA) for hip replacement in 2008. He is the UK's most experienced surgeon in DAA hip replacement.
Professor Field has built up one of the world’s largest and most comprehensive databases on the outcome of hip and knee replacement and has published extensively on hip preservation and joint replacement surgery. He was an advisor on Hip replacement to the National Institute of Clinical Excellence (NICE), a board member of the British Hip Society and President of ISHA, the International Society for Hip Preservation Surgery. He continues to teach and lecture, in the UK and abroad, on hip and knee surgery.
